Frequently Asked Questions

Chula Vista's cost of living index is 111.5 vs McAllen's 85.6 (US average = 100). McAllen is 26% less expensive overall.

Chula Vista, CA and McAllen, TX are about 1,211 miles apart (straight-line distance). Driving distance will be longer depending on the route.
